batch file pause on error
Pause on error in Batch File (Example) - Don't you hate it when you write a beautiful batch script, then run it only to discover it fails miserably? Don't check for 1, even though it automatically checks for anything equal-to-or-greater (source), because technically scripts can return negative numbers.
Slowing a batch file down to read errors - The newly opened window will not be closed when an error occurs. To stop a batch script before it ends, put the pause command on a new
How to prevent batch window from closing when error occurs - You need to pass the /K switch to CMD, or just open a Command Window and run the batch from the command line.
3 Ways To Prevent Command Prompt From Closing After Running - When we run any batch file, the Command Prompt window will appear Prompt From Closing After Running Commands (Batch File Pause).
pause - You can insert the pause command before a section of the batch file that you might not want to process. When pause suspends processing of the batch program, you can press CTRL+C and then press Y to stop the batch program.
windows - COM blithely continue executing batch files even in the face of In general, error handling in the Windows shell is very non-sophisticated.
Batch file pauses for no reason - Every now and then I see a strange pause in TCC batch execution. Can a command line app finish without an error, but not report this to Win
Preventing an MS-DOS window from automatically closing in Windows - Add a pause statement to a batch file If you are creating a batch file and want the MS-DOS window to remain open, one trick is to add PAUSE to the end of your batch file, which will prompt the user to press any key. Until the user presses any key, the window will remain open instead of closing automatically.
windows - And general command line usage as well: Here is their site. You can add a PAUSE command at the end if you want the command line to stay
Batch file - A batch file is a script file in DOS, OS/2 and Microsoft Windows. It consists of a series of . PAUSE. To execute the file, it must be saved with the extension .bat ( or .cmd for Windows NT-type operating systems) in plain text format, typically created by Similarly, if %foo% contains abc def , then a different syntax error results:.
return error code from batch file
Batch File Return Code - Explanation And Example - Use EXIT /B < exitcodes > at the end of the batch file to return custom return codes. Environment variable %ERRORLEVEL% contains the latest errorlevel in the batch file, which is the latest error codes from the last command executed.
Batch Script - Return Code - Program is not recognized as an internal or external command, operable program or batch file. Indicates that command, application name or path has been misspelled when configuring the Action. Indicates that the executed program has terminated abnormally or crashed. Indicates that Windows has run out of memory.
Windows Batch Scripting: Return Codes - Today we'll cover return codes as the right way to communicate the IF ERRORLEVEL 1 ( REM do something here to address the error ) return codes with easy to read SET statements at the top of your script file, like this:
How do I get the application exit code from a Windows command line - When a windowed application eventually exits, its exit status is lost. If you want to match the error code exactly (eg equals 0), use this: . So if you have two commands in the batch script and the first fails, the ERRORLEVEL will remain set even after the second Here is the temporary file contents part:
Exit - Terminate a script - Windows CMD - EXIT. Quit the current batch script, quit the current subroutine or quit the command processor (CMD.EXE) optionally EXE If executed from outside a batch script, if will quit CMD.exe exitCode Sets the Echo If we get this far the file was found.
Errorlevel - Windows CMD - The exit codes that are set do vary, in general a code of 0 (false) will indicate A .CMD batch file running the above will display an error after the command that
What is Powershell exit code? - the exit status. This document provides steps on how to return error codes on Powershell scripts. Powershell script for copying file to a folder $dest ="C: est"
Close and exit batch files - And every batch file needs to quit, and will do so, when it reaches the last line of code. There are several ways to end batch file execution, like
How to return success/failure from a batch file? - How do I return 0 for success ate the end of an MSDOS batch file? Similarly, how exitCode specifies a numeric number. if /B is specified, sets
Send Exit Code from Batch File (SetExitC Utility) - If error handling has not been coded in the batch file, only the exit code returned by the final command is sent to CA WA ESP Edition by the
windows batch file terminate on error
How do I make a batch file terminate upon encountering an error - See also question about exiting batch file subroutine. . Here is a polyglot program for BASH and Windows CMD that runs a series of 2 || goto :error command 3 || goto :error :; exit 0 exit /b 0 :error exit /b %errorlevel%.
How do I make a batch file - EXIT. Quit the current batch script, quit the current subroutine or quit the to set a specific errorlevel, EXIT /b 0 for sucess, EXIT /b 1 (or greater) for an error.
Exit - Terminate a script - Windows CMD - A protip by zaus about debug, batch, windows, and batch file. And if you want your batch file to expose the last error, exit with the same code:
Pause on error in Batch File (Example) - EXE and COMMAND.COM blithely continue executing batch files even in the face of errors. Checking the errorlevel of programs you call is
windows - When a batch script returns a non-zero value after the execution fails, the non- zero to execute non-recognized command in Windows command prompt cmd. exe. EXIT /B %ERRORLEVEL% at the end of the batch file to return the error
Batch Script - Return Code - Presumming the cmds are other .bat files stack the commands like this: The /c flag tells the interpreter to terminate as soon as the command
windows - By default, the command processor will continue executing when an error is raised. You have to code for halting on error. A very simple way to halt on error is to use the EXIT command with the /B switch (to exit the current batch script context, and not the command prompt process).
Windows Batch Scripting: Return Codes - Applies To: Windows Server (Semi-Annual Channel), Windows Server 2016, If executed from outside a batch script, exits Cmd.exe. If you are quitting Cmd. exe, the process exit code is set to that number. Liquid error: Can't find the localized string giveDocumentationFeedback for template Conceptual.
exit - The called batch file should set ERRORLEVEL non-zero if error :: **** call test.bat -stop if ERRORLEVEL 1 (call error.bat) echo. echo Control was returned to